Start Free TrialWild Life (Protection) Amendment Act, 2002 Section 2
Title: Amendment of Long Title
State: Central
Year: 2002
In the Wild Life (Protection) Act, 1972 (53 of 1972) (hereinafter referred to as the principal Act), for the long title, the following long title shall be substituted, namely:-- "An Act to provide for the protection of wild animals, birds and plants and for matters connected therewith or ancillary or incidental thereto with a view to ensuring the ecological and environmental security of the country.".
View Complete Act List Judgments citing this sectionPre-natal Diagnostic Techniques (Regulation and Prevention of Misuse) Amendment Act, 2002 Section 2
Title: Substitution of Long Title
State: Central
Year: 2002
In the Pre-natal Diagnostic Techniques (Regulation and Prevention of Misuse)Act, 1994 (57 of 1994) (hereinafter referred to as the principal Act), for the long title, the following long title shall be substituted, namely:-- "An Act to provide for the prohibition of sex selection, before or after conception, and for regulation of pre-natal diagnostic techniques for the purposes of detecting genetic abnormalities or metabolic disorders or chromosomal abnormalities or certain congenital malformations or sex-linked disorders and for the prevention of their misuse for sex determination leading to female foeticide and for matters connected therewith or incidental thereto.".
View Complete Act List Judgments citing this sectionNational Co-operative Development Corporation (Amendment) Act, 2002 Section 2
Title: Amendment of Long Title
State: Central
Year: 2002
In the National Co-operative Development Corporation Act, 1962 (hereinafter referred to as the principal Act), in the long title, for the words "and certain other commodities on co-operative principles and for matters connected therewith", the words "industrial goods, livestock, certain other commodities and services on co-operative principles and for matters connected therewith or incidental thereto" shall be substituted.

View Complete Act List Judgments citing this sectionFinance Act, 2002 Section 29
Title: Amendment of Section 74
State: Central
Year: 2002
In section 74 of the Income-tax Act, with effect from the 1st day of April, 2003,- (a) for sub-section (1), the following sub-section shall be substituted, namely:- '(i) Where in respect of any assessment year, the net result of the computation under the head "Capital gains" is a loss to the assessee, the whole loss shall, subject to the other provisions of this Chapter, be carried forward to the following assessment year, and-- (a) in so far as such loss relates to a short-term capital asset, it shall be set off against income, if any, under the head "Capital gains" assessable for that assessment year in respect of any other capital asset; (b) in so far as such loss relates to a long-term capital asset, it shall be set off against income, if any, under the head "Capital gains" assessable for that assessment year in respect of any other capital asset not being a short-term capital asset; (c) if the loss cannot be wholly so set off, the amount of loss not so set off shall be carried forward to the following assessment year and so on.'; (b) sub-section (3) shall be omitted.
